Branded Uniforms vs Marketing Materials: Which to Choose?

Compare branded uniforms and marketing materials to decide which suits your business needs best.

Top Gun Solutions2 min read

When it comes to enhancing brand visibility, many businesses find themselves torn between investing in branded uniforms or marketing materials. Both options effectively communicate your brand, but choosing the right one depends on your specific business needs.

Branded Uniforms

Branded uniforms are clothing items that display your company logo or message. They transform your employees into walking advertisements. Uniforms work well for businesses where employees interact directly with customers. They reinforce brand identity and create a professional image.

Who Benefits from Uniforms?

  • Customer-facing businesses: Restaurants, retail stores, and service providers benefit from the uniform approach as it fosters trust and professionalism.
  • Events and promotions: Wearing branded apparel at events can help your team stand out and increase brand recognition.

What is the Effort?

Implementing branded uniforms requires some effort. You'll need to choose a design, ensure proper sizing, and manage inventory. However, once set up, it simplifies dress code management and boosts team spirit.

Marketing Materials

Marketing materials encompass a variety of print and digital products, such as brochures, flyers, and business cards. They serve as tangible reminders of your brand.

Who Benefits from Marketing Materials?

  • Businesses with diverse offerings: Companies with a broad range of products or services can use marketing materials to present detailed information.
  • Networking and outreach: Handing out business cards or brochures during meetings can leave a lasting impression.

What is the Effort?

Creating marketing materials involves design, production, and distribution. It can be time-consuming but allows flexibility in targeting different audiences with tailored messages.

Overlap and Divergence

Both branded uniforms and marketing materials aim to enhance brand visibility. Where they overlap is in their ability to create a cohesive brand image and communicate professionalism. However, they diverge in their application and impact.

  • Uniforms offer ongoing brand exposure through employee interactions, whereas marketing materials provide one-time impact with potential for broader reach.
  • The cost structure also differs; uniforms incur an upfront investment, while marketing materials can have ongoing costs related to reprints and updates.

Decision Rule

If your business relies heavily on face-to-face interactions with customers, branded uniforms might be the way to go. They instill confidence and create a professional environment. On the other hand, if your focus is on reaching a wider audience through information distribution, investing in marketing materials could better suit your needs.
